The Latest HIV Cure Is the First of Its Kind

The Latest HIV Cure Is the First of Its Kind

Doctors say they’ve likely cured yet another person of HIV using a specialized form of stem cell transplant. The patient has remained HIV-free for six years and is the first known woman to have successfully undergone the procedure. Free AI Art Generator Midjourney Launches a Magazine

Free AI Art Generator Midjourney Launches a Magazine

Midjourney is launching a monthly print magazine, “Midjourney.” A subscription will cost $4 per month, though you can get the first issue gratis if you sign up fast, according to the Wednesday announcement.
